Dr Mohamed Shariff
Consultant Gastroenterologist
BMBch MA (Oxon) MRCP PhD
Specialises in:
  • Gastroenterology
  • Hepatology
  • Pancreatology

Professional profile

I am a Consultant Gastroenterologist and my NHS practice is at West Hertfordshire NHS Teaching Hospitals. I undertook my medical school training at Oxford University and my registrar training in London, pursuing sub-specility interests in liver and biliary medicine at King’s College Hospital, Imperial College and The Royal London Hospitals.  I also undertook a PhD in liver cancer research at Imperial college London in 2012.

I undertake endoscopy procedures including gastroscopy and colonoscopy. In my NHS practice I also undertake advanced endoscopy including endoscopic ultrasound (EUS) and endoscopic retrograde cholangiopancreatography (ERCP)

I am currently the lead for Hepatobiliary Medicine at my NHS trust and have previously held roles of Clinical Lead and Divisional Digital Lead.
